Learn the Science of Carbohydrates for Peak Performance
Whether your clients are training for strength, endurance, or general health, understanding what carbohydrates are and how they work in the body is essential. This CEC course explores the different types of carbohydrates—including complex, refined, and unrefined—so you can better support your clients’ nutrition goals. You’ll uncover the truth about daily carbohydrate intake, carbohydrates after workouts, and how to use carbs to enhance athletic performance and recovery. Learn the latest nutrition research so you can shift the carb conversation from fear to fuel and help clients reach their goals.

What You’ll Gain From This CEC
This course goes beyond simply answering “What is a carbohydrate?”—it gives you a practical framework to guide your clients toward better performance and health through smart carb strategies. You’ll learn to:
- Define carbohydrates and explain their important functions in everyday nutrition and athletic performance
- Break down the recommended daily intake of carbohydrates and adjust for specific health and fitness goals
- Distinguish between the types of carbohydrates and their roles in energy metabolism and recovery
- Recommend optimal carbohydrates to eat before a workout and the best post workout carbohydrates to support energy, endurance, and muscle repair
